NeighbourhoodThis semi-detached house on Sint Lambertusstraat sits in the quiet village of Engelen, part of Den Bosch. With 114 m² of living space and a generous 578 m² plot, it offers room to breathe both indoors and out. The asking price of €685,000 is 22% below the neighbourhood average of €873,957, making it a keen option compared to other semi-detached houses in Den Bosch.
Kom Engelen has a village feel with mostly families and a high proportion of owner-occupied homes (86%). One resident describes it as "Friendly. People nice neighbourhood. Could use more nature." The area is quiet, with a low urbanity score (5 out of 5), and the neighbourhood Kom Engelen has a strong sense of community.
For your daily shopping, the PLUS supermarket is just around the corner, and a Lidl and Aldi are a short drive away. Primary schools are within walking distance: Basisschool De Pollenhof and Openbare Basisschool De Lispeltuut are both a couple of streets away. The municipality Den Bosch provides good amenities, though secondary schools and the train station are further out.

The asking price of €685,000 is 22% below the average asking price in Kom Engelen (€873,957) and also below the median of €875,000. However, the home is smaller than average (114 m² vs 193 m²). Given the large plot and the lower price per square metre, it represents good value for a semi-detached house in this neighbourhood.
The home has energy label D. In Kom Engelen, 21.7% of homes have label D or lower, while the majority (78.3%) have better labels (A, B, or C). Label D means the home is moderately efficient, so you can expect higher energy costs compared to a more modern home.
The plot measures 578 m², which is significantly larger than the neighbourhood average. This gives you plenty of outdoor space for a garden, patio, or even extensions (subject to planning permission). The exact layout and possibilities are best discussed with the agent.
Kom Engelen is a quiet, family-friendly village with a low crime rate (47 total offences). Most homes are owner-occupied (86%) and the population is diverse in age, with a good mix of families and older residents. One resident describes it as friendly, though they note it could use more nature.
The nearest train station is 5.7 km away, so it's not within walking distance. You would need a bike or car to reach it. The station provides connections to Den Bosch and other cities.
Yes, there are several primary schools within a couple of kilometres, including Basisschool De Pollenhof (2.5 km) and Openbare Basisschool De Lispeltuut (2.6 km). For secondary education, the nearest school is 3.1 km away.
